Song Meaning
The lyrics paint a picture of someone desperately trying to get the attention of a partner who seems distant and emotionally checked out. The repeated "hello hello" acts as a frantic, almost pleading attempt to bridge a growing gap, highlighting the narrator's confusion and hurt. The immediate question, "지금 내 말 듣고 있니" (Are you listening to me right now?), sets the stage for a one-sided conversation where the narrator feels unheard and unseen.
The central tension arises from the perceived change in the partner's behavior. The narrator notes the absence of previously intimate gestures, like the "이마 키스" (forehead kiss), and the delayed text replies, all signaling a shift from "자상한 남자" (caring man) to someone becoming "귀찮은 여자" (bothersome woman) in his eyes. This contrast between past affection and present coldness fuels the narrator's anxiety and self-doubt.
The most striking element is the recurring image of the partner "도망치는 사람 같아" (like someone running away), especially when the narrator pleads, "자꾸 빨리 걸어가지마" (Don't keep walking away so fast). This physical metaphor for emotional distance is palpable, as the narrator longs for simple connection: "손도 잡고 팔짱 끼고 발맞추며 걷고 싶은데" (I want to hold your hand, link arms, and walk in step). The repeated "hello baby" becomes a desperate cry into an unresponsive void.
This song hits hard because it captures the painful experience of feeling invisible to someone you love. The narrator's raw vulnerability, expressed through questions and pleas, makes the emotional disconnect feel immediate and relatable. The writing effectively uses simple, direct language to convey a profound sense of loss and the desperate hope for a return to intimacy, making the listener feel the sting of being ignored.
